KEEPING UP WITH THE KEEPERS
I caught up with Jordan Jones, to get the latest from The Keepers camp, since their phenomenal performance at Twinfest in the summer.
We’ve also been writing a LOT of new songs, we seem to be firing on all cylinders as a band now and stuff is flying about the place a lot more. It’s great we now have four members who write or contribute from a wide range of influences and have a wider technical and creative palette than before. Gig wise we are focussing on a lot more London gigs and we have some good contacts on the international side which we hope to announce early next year. We have a lot more admin work and marketing jazz to do with our batch of new recordings which I think show our sound developing and going up a gear. We are also playing Paris on the 9th Nov.
Up next for the band, is the release of new single, Hope, at the end of November, with 4 more planned for release in 2020, making 8 joyous months of new tunes to look forward to.
